Discovering Animal Sounds Through Music

Every safari animal has its own unique sound and movement.

Try using instruments to represent different animals:

🎵 Drums for the heavy footsteps of an elephant

🎵 Shakers for rustling leaves in the jungle

🎵 Rainmakers for tropical weather

🎵 Bells for playful monkeys swinging through the trees

🎵 Guiros or scraping instruments for insects and jungle creatures

Encourage children and adults to decide which instruments best represent their favourite safari animals.

There are no right or wrong answers, only opportunities for creativity and self-expression.

Safari Musical Activities to Try at Home

Animal Movement Parade

Choose a safari animal and move like that animal while music plays.

Can you stomp like an elephant?

Stretch like a giraffe?

Leap like a monkey?

Crawl like a lion?

This activity supports coordination, body awareness, and imaginative play.

Jungle Sound Hunt

Create different animal sounds using your voice, instruments, or household objects.

Can everyone guess which animal you are pretending to be?

This is a fantastic activity for developing listening and communication skills.

Musical Safari Story

Create an adventure story together.

Perhaps you're travelling through the jungle searching for lions, crossing rivers filled with crocodiles, or spotting zebras grazing on the plains.

Use instruments to bring each part of the story to life.

Follow the Animal Rhythm

Tap a simple rhythm on a drum or table and invite others to copy it.

You could pretend each rhythm belongs to a different safari animal.

This supports attention, memory, and turn-taking skills.

Sensory Safari Play

Safari themes offer plenty of opportunities for sensory exploration.

You might explore:

🌿 Artificial grass or leaves

🪶 Feathers

🪨 Natural materials such as stones and bark

🦓 Animal-themed fabrics and textures

🎨 Safari-themed sensory trays

Combining sensory experiences with music helps create a rich and engaging learning environment.
